Match 43 IPL 2011:Chennai Superkings Vs Rajasthan Royals { Chennai Super Kings crush Rajasthan Royals by 8 wickets }

Defending champions Chennai Super Kings (CSK) crushed Rajasthan Royals (RR) by eight wickets to notch up their fourth win on the trot in ten outings in the Indian Premier League (IPL) at the M A Chidambaram Stadium here this evening.


Batting first, the visitors put up 147 for six in their 20 overs and,in response, CSK rattled up 149 for two in 18.4 overs on the strength of a brilliant unbeaten 79 by opener Michael Hussey and 61 by left-hander Suresh Raina in front of a wildly cheering home crowd.
Hussey and Raina put on 137 forthe second wicket. Hussey's 79 came off 55 balls and included eight fours and one six, while Raina's 61 was made from 51 balls and contained three fours and a six.
CSK were off to a poor start in their chase, losing opener MuraliVijay (5), before Hussey and Raina got together for a partnership that took the game away from Rajasthan.
Rahul Dravid topscored for Rajasthan Royals with 66, with his opening partner Shane Watson contributing 32. Ross Taylor (20) was the only other batsman to cross into double figures today.
